Formaldehyde is not considered an organic acid. It is a simple organic compound that is used as a precursor to many other chemicals and materials. It does not contain a carboxyl group (-COOH), which is a defining characteristic of organic acids.
Yes, hydrocarbons are a major class of organic compounds that are composed of carbon and hydrogen atoms. They form the basis of many important organic molecules, such as alkanes, alkenes, and alkynes.
The main reason organic molecules do not spontaneously form and remain intact today is the presence of more reactive chemicals and environmental factors that lead to their breakdown. Additionally, the conditions on Earth today are not as conducive to the formation and preservation of organic molecules as they were in the early stages of the planet's history.

Organic molecules are essential. Almost everything you can touch or see is an organic molecule. Your body is composed primarily of water and organic molecules. Food is organic, and medicines are almost exclusively organic molecules. Most surfaces are organic, including wood and plastics. Without organic molecules, you wouldn't exist!

All organic molecules are comprised of covalent bonds between hydrogen atoms and carbon atoms. There are many other elements that play a role in modifying the structure of organic molecules, such as oxygen, phosphorous, and nitrogen.
